OpenAFS Master Repository branch, openafs-devel-1_7_x, updated. openafs-devel-1_7_8-40-g121d0d6

Gerrit Code Review
Fri, 6 Apr 2012 14:38:59 -0700 (PDT)

The following commit has been merged in the openafs-devel-1_7_x branch:
commit 121d0d6b1554a980991392eb0a8a2d2541b5e341
Author: Jeffrey Altman <>
Date:   Mon Apr 2 18:10:07 2012 -0400

    Windows: Name Array store mount point and volume root
    Modify the Name Array processing to store both the mount point
    object and the volume root directory object in the array.  This
    is necessary for proper operation of
    AFSPopulateNameArrayFromRelatedArray when the DirectoryCB parameter
    is a mount point object.
    Modify AFSBackupEntry to remove two entries if a volume root
    directory entry is being removed.
    Remove AFSReplaceCurrentElement() as it is no longer used.
    Reviewed-by: Jeffrey Altman <>
    Tested-by: Jeffrey Altman <>
    (cherry picked from commit 3db44bacd4b3ac3b9ed63bcf671b03f7f7eeb8af)
    Change-Id: I66711639c41515c0b6ae6cd6263d45457fa668d0
    Tested-by: BuildBot <>
    Reviewed-by: Jeffrey Altman <>
    Tested-by: Jeffrey Altman <>

 src/WINNT/afsrdr/kernel/lib/AFSGeneric.cpp      |   86 ++++-------------------
 src/WINNT/afsrdr/kernel/lib/AFSNameSupport.cpp  |    7 +-
 src/WINNT/afsrdr/kernel/lib/Include/AFSCommon.h |    4 -
 3 files changed, 19 insertions(+), 78 deletions(-)

OpenAFS Master Repository